An attempt has been made to resume the workflow instance by invoking ResumeInstance method on workflow engine, which is not supported when the underlying workflow process has the special WFSESSIONAFFINITY process property defined.
Scope
This document is informational and intended for any user.
SBL-BPR-00597: Cannot resume process instance '%1'. An attempt has been made to resume the workflow instance by invoking ResumeInstance method on workflow engine, which is not supported when the underlying workflow process has the special WF...
Explanation
Workflow processes with the process property WFSESSIONAFFINITY defined are meant to support session affinity, i.e., workflow instances started at a user session can be resumed from the same session. When ResumeInstance method is called on workflow engine, there is no way for workflow engine to tell which session the instance of interest was originally started. Therefore, the session affinity feature and the ResumeInstance method cannot be supported at the same time.Corrective Action
Please either remove the WFSESSIONAFFINITY process property from the process definition or try to resume the workflow process through means other than ResumeInstance.SBL-BPR-00596: Error loading process definition '%1'. Explanation
This business service requires that a context business component be set before calling the business service.Corrective Action
In the code invoking the business service, set the context business component by calling SetBusComp() method on the service instance before calling InvokeMethod().SBL-BPR-00593: User Property '%1' not specified for Business Service '%2'.

Explanation
This business service requires that its SRF definition specifies this user property.Corrective Action
In Siebel Tools, add specified user property. If Business Service Use Property type does not appear in the Object Explorer, open View/Options dialog and in Object Explorer select this type.SBL-BPR-00592: Task ' %1 ' is of type sub-task. Cannot launch a task which is of type sub-task.
